VBsupport перешел с домена .ORG на родной .RU
Ура!
Пожалуйста, обновите свои закладки - VBsupport.ru
Блок РКН снят, форум доступен на всей территории России, включая новые терртории, без VPN
На форуме введена премодерация ВСЕХ новых пользователей
Почта с временных сервисов, типа mailinator.com, gawab.com и/или прочих, которые предоставляют временный почтовый ящик без регистрации и/или почтовый ящик для рассылки спама, отслеживается и блокируется, а так же заносится в спам-блок форума, аккаунты удаляются
Если вы хотите приобрести какой то скрипт/продукт/хак из каталогов перечисленных ниже: Каталог модулей/хаков
Ещё раз обращаем Ваше внимание: всё, что Вы скачиваете и устанавливаете на свой форум, Вы устанавливаете исключительно на свой страх и риск.
Сообщество vBSupport'а физически не в состоянии проверять все стили, хаки и нули, выкладываемые пользователями.
Помните: безопасность Вашего проекта - Ваша забота. Убедительная просьба: при обнаружении уязвимостей или сомнительных кодов обязательно отписывайтесь в теме хака/стиля
Спасибо за понимание
Редирект для забаненых пользователей.
Вы указываете URL на который будет
отправлен забаненый пользователь
(можно указать любую группу пользователей)
В админ панели появляется
"Пользователи -> Redirect Banned"
Вводите Url и готово.
Если мод будет востребован, то возможно
его дальнейшее улучшение Пишите в личку.
var $UserGroup=1; // Номер группы пользователей для редиректа
var $RbuFolder='rbuurlban'; //имя файла для записи урл
Открываем файл login.php :
Найти:
Code:
// do redirect
do_login_redirect();
заменить на
Code:
require_once("rbu.php");
$rbuban= new rbu_redirect;
if ($vbulletin->userinfo["usergroupid"]==$rbuban->UserGroup){include('rbu_redirect.php');}else{do_login_redirect();}
Готово;)
Возможные улучшения:
* Установка времени редиректа через админ панель
* Изменение информации на странице при редиректе через админ панель
* Установка редиректа для нескольких групп
Location: Улыбаемся и машем, машем и улыбаемся... :)ь
Награды в конкурсах:
Posts: 2,972
Версия vB: 1.x.x
Reputation:
Professional 870
Репутация в разделе: 503
0
спасибо большое
а на 3,5,4 пойдет???
сколько запросов в бд делает??
@JoLTiy
Продвинутый
Join Date: Jul 2006
Location: Москва
Posts: 42
Версия vB: 3.6.1
Reputation:
Опытный 24
Репутация в разделе: 24
0
Он не делает запросов в БД А УРЛ перенаправления хранит в файле)) Я посчитал что так лучше для производительности
добавлено через 2 минуты
Должно пойти! Если нет, напиши, поправим. Если это тот мод который ты хотел, то можно еще парочку функций добавить, которые тебе нужны.
Last edited by JoLTiy : 10-29-2006 at 09:18 PM.
Reason: Добавлено сообщение
@Мик
Эксперт
Join Date: Mar 2006
Location: Улыбаемся и машем, машем и улыбаемся... :)ь
Награды в конкурсах:
Posts: 2,972
Версия vB: 1.x.x
Reputation:
Professional 870
Репутация в разделе: 503
0
Quote:
Originally Posted by JoLTiy
Он не делает запросов в БД А УРЛ перенаправления хранит в файле)) Я посчитал что так лучше для производительности
добавлено через 2 минуты
Должно пойти! Если нет, напиши, поправим. Если это тот мод который ты хотел, то можно еще парочку функций добавить, которые тебе нужны.
вот бы значь, что я еще хочу
@JoLTiy
Продвинутый
Join Date: Jul 2006
Location: Москва
Posts: 42
Версия vB: 3.6.1
Reputation:
Опытный 24
Репутация в разделе: 24
0
Ну ты хорошенько подумай ;)
Я этот скрипт быстренько настряпал... мне понравилось, очень легко писать модули для булки (правда если качественные делать, много времени )
Теперь буду писать что нить полезное для своего форума.
добавлено через 1 час 14 минут
во! вспомнил кое-что.
я полный извращенец!
в общем такая идея!
есть классная флешка http://nashguu.ru/banned.swf
если к ней дописать кое-что http://nashguu.ru/banned.swf?namee=JelSoft
то мы видим немного другую флешку
вопрос: как дописать в код ник заблокированного пользователя
+ если будет учтен перевод кирилици в латиницу (например я=ya)? то будет ваще суперски
Last edited by sash : 10-30-2006 at 03:10 PM.
Reason: Добавлено сообщение
@JoLTiy
Продвинутый
Join Date: Jul 2006
Location: Москва
Posts: 42
Версия vB: 3.6.1
Reputation:
Опытный 24
Репутация в разделе: 24
0
Quote:
как дописать в код ник заблокированного пользователя
Ты хочешь, что бы пользователь был отправлен на эту флэшку и его имя было вставленно в этот постер?
Если да, то это очень легко делается, могу дописать.
Quote:
если будет учтен перевод кирилици в латиницу (например я=ya)? то будет ваще суперски
Можно конечно. Я недавно такое реализовывал на ява скрипт, что бы автоматически название новостей при наберании перекодировал для человеко понятных урлов Думаю можно такое добавить... тока сегодня не смогу,надо курсовик делать(( но в среду выложу, до среды оставляйте свои пожелания
@sash
Специалист
Join Date: Sep 2005
Location: http://nashguu.ru
Posts: 437
Reputation:
Professional 340
Репутация в разделе: 348
0
Quote:
Originally Posted by JoLTiy
Ты хочешь, что бы пользователь был отправлен на эту флэшку и его имя было вставленно в этот постер?
Если да, то это очень легко делается, могу дописать.
ты верно меня понял
Quote:
Originally Posted by JoLTiy
Можно конечно. Я недавно такое реализовывал на ява скрипт, что бы автоматически название новостей при наберании перекодировал для человеко понятных урлов Думаю можно такое добавить... тока сегодня не смогу,надо курсовик делать(( но в среду выложу, до среды оставляйте свои пожелания
на 3.6.4 неработает , в файле установил группу 8 ( блокированые ) , но редиректа нету только сообщение о блокировке , может я чтото нето делаю ? в строке редиректа указал http://nashguu.ru/banned.swf?namee=BANNED
аа сорри все работает разлогинится забыл.... спасибо ! за хак
Last edited by xorex : 03-23-2007 at 09:31 AM.
@mastah
Знаток
Join Date: Jan 2008
Location: эгрегор
Posts: 672
Версия vB: 3.8.1
Reputation:
Knowing 267
Репутация в разделе: 262
0
а с флешкой идея умерла? а то хороша (хоть флешки и нет больше по этим ссылкам)